i would need you to disassemble the alternator and you can send it apo when it is done i will give you a call paypal the funds or send a check m.o and i will send it back to ya....the reason you need to disassemble it is because i take all the casting flaws off the metal to give it that billet look those aluminum shavings dont need to be in the alternator when you get it back i figure 40 for that figure they are 50 plus shipping to and from in the states let me know bro
